SB 193 Alabama Senate · 2026 Regular Session

Contract Review Permanent Legislative Oversight Committee, review of personal or professional services contracts, limitation that funds be issued on a state warrant removed, occupational and professional licensing boards included as state entities

SB 193 expands oversight of state contracts by requiring the Contract Review Permanent Legislative Oversight Committee to review all personal or professional services contracts entered by occupational and professional licensing boards (like those for doctors, lawyers, or contractors), which were previously excluded. It removes the current restriction that only contracts paid via state warrants (a specific payment method) needed committee review, now requiring review for all such contracts funded by state or federal appropriations. This change directly affects licensing boards by subjecting their spending to legislative scrutiny, ensuring all contracts for services they purchase undergo committee review. The bill amends Alabama Code Section 29-2-41 and takes effect October 1, 2026.
